Ron Brewer (born March 11, 1937) is a former professional Canadian football linebacker who played ten seasons in the Canadian Football League for the Toronto Argonauts, Montreal Alouettes, Edmonton Eskimos and the Hamilton Tiger-Cats.

He was named for the all-Argonaut Team in 1974 for the modern era of 1945-1973, selected by the Argonaut alumni and the sports media.
